Fax: 1-866-418-0232. … TSP is an FCC program that directs telecommunications service providers … WebThe Nationwide Wireless Priority Service (WPS) is a system in the United States that allows high-priority emergency telephone calls to avoid congestion on wireless telephone networks. This complements the Government Emergency Telecommunications Service (GETS), which allows such calls to avoid congestion on landline networks. WebTelecommunications Service Priority. TSP is available for land line phone and data circuits at critical facilities. TSP identifies those circuits for priority restoration if service is lost. Basically, they are first in line for being repaired. There is a monthly cost from your provider for TSP circuits.
